Peterborough, On vs Bergen - Florida Climate & Distance Between

Norway flag
  • The distance between Peterborough, On, Canada and Bergen - Florida, Norway is approximately 5,539 km or 3,442 mi.
  • To reach Peterborough, On in this distance one would set out from Bergen - Florida bearing 291.2°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Peterborough, On bearing 220° or SW .
  • Peterborough, On has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Bergen - Florida has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Peterborough, On is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Bergen - Florida is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 1.8 °C (3.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.8 °C (28.4°F) more in Peterborough, On.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1421.3 mm (56 in) less which is equivalent to 1421.3 l/m² (34.88 US gal/ft²) or 14,213,000 l/ha (1,519,464 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 16.1° higher in Peterborough, On than in Bergen - Florida.
